What You’ll Do
Perform routine maintenance across properties including plumbing, electrical, carpentry, and HVAC systems
Conduct regular inspections of buildings, grounds, and equipment to identify and resolve issues early
Respond to tenant maintenance requests in a timely and professional manner
Troubleshoot and repair common issues such as leaks, electrical problems, and appliance malfunctions
Perform lawn and grounds maintenance including mowing, weed eating, leaf removal, and snow removal
Prepare vacant units for new tenants including painting, cleaning, and minor repairs
Assemble and install furniture, fixtures, and other equipment as needed
Coordinate with outside contractors for specialized repairs or large-scale maintenance work
Maintain accurate records of maintenance tasks, repairs, and time worked
Provide weekly updates to the Property Manager on completed work, pending tasks, and any property concerns
Respond to emergency maintenance requests when needed, including occasional after-hours support

What You’ll Bring
High school diploma or equivalent (technical certification is a plus)
Proven experience in property maintenance, facilities maintenance, or building repairs
Working knowledge of plumbing, electrical, and HVAC systems
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ills
Ability to manage multiple maintenance tasks across different properties
Excellent communication and customer service skills when working with tenants
Valid driver’s license and reliable transportation
Physical ability to lift and carry heavy items and perform tasks that require standing, bending, and walking for extended periods
